Facts about Time For Travelin'

✔️

Who wrote Time For Travelin' lyrics?


Time For Travelin' is written by Joe Ely.
✔️

When was Time For Travelin' released?


It is first released in 1979 as part of Joe Ely's album "Down On the Drag" which includes 10 tracks in total. This song is the 8th track on this album.
✔️

Which genre is Time For Travelin'?


Time For Travelin' falls under the genre Country.
✔️

How long is the song Time For Travelin'?


Time For Travelin' song length is 4 minutes and 08 seconds.
